The recruitment arm of Derby-based Ford and Stanley Talent Services Group has announced the strategic promotion of four key team members to further bolster its leadership capabilities. The move is part of an overarching strategy to enhance service delivery and drive further business growth, amid a series of recent contract wins and strong growth during 2024.
Billy Jackson has been promoted from Managing Consultant to Principal Consultant with Ford & Stanley Executive Search after 3.5 years with the company. Tom Norton steps into his new role as Head of Executive Search following a successful tenure as Business Manager over the past 2.5 years.
Meanwhile, Paige Roome-Hanson moves from Senior Recruitment Consultant to Managing Consultant within Ford & Stanley Recruitment after three successful years with the company. Callum Wildes has also been promoted to Senior Recruitment Consultant (Interim and Contract opportunities), having been with the company for just over a year.
